Diving into the world of hacking often leads to one question: "Can I hire a hacker?". The answer is a resounding yes, but with a vital caveat - understanding the difference between ethical and black hat hackers. Ethical professionals operate within legal boundaries, supporting organizations strengthen their infrastructure. They conduct penetration tests to expose weaknesses before malicious actors can exploit them. Conversely, black hat hackers are the antagonists, using their skills for illegal purposes like data exfiltration. Engaging a black hat hacker is not only ethically wrong but also criminal and can lead to severe repercussions.

  • Thus, always choose an ethical hacker who adheres to a strict code of conduct and is honest about their methods.

Recruiting Ethical Hackers

In today's digital landscape, online vulnerabilities are more prevalent than ever. To stay ahead of the curve, businesses need to proactively safeguard their systems and data. One crucial step in this endeavor is hiring ethical hackers, also known as penetration testers or vulnerability analysts. These skilled professionals can uncover weaknesses in your systems before malicious actors take advantage of them.

Recruiting ethical hackers legally requires a clear understanding of the regulatory landscape and best practices. Businesses need to establish a robust hiring process that adhere to industry standards. This includes conducting thorough background checks, confirming expertise, and establishing clear contracts.

Additionally, businesses should build a culture of shared responsibility when it comes to cybersecurity. This means welcoming ethical hacking initiatives, providing training opportunities, and establishing a secure environment for employees to identify weaknesses without fear of reprisal.

By adopting these practices, businesses can utilize the expertise of ethical hackers while ensuring legal compliance and mitigating cybersecurity challenges.
